Job Summary
A growing clinical research site is seeking an experienced and motivated Clinical Research Coordinator II/III to join their on-site team full-time. This role is ideal for someone with a strong background in coordinating clinical trials and a genuine passion for patient interaction and quality care. The organization partners with physician practices and research sponsors to expand patient access to clinical trials and bring innovative treatments directly into the community.
Key Responsibilities
- Coordinate all aspects of assigned clinical trials from initiation through close-out
- Maintain accurate source documentation and ensure data integrity
- Prepare and submit regulatory documents and IRB correspondence as required
- Support patient visits and ensure adherence to study protocols
- Monitor and report adverse events per sponsor and regulatory requirements
- Collaborate with investigators, study monitors, and cross-functional staff to ensure smooth study operations
- Maintain compliance with study timelines and site goals
Qualifications
- Minimum of 3 years of clinical research coordination experience
- Strong understanding of clinical trial processes and GCP guidelines
- CCRC certification preferred but not required
- Excellent attention to detail, organizational, and communication skills
- Ability to work independently while contributing to a collaborative team culture
